Since … WebAug 21, 2024 · The bond enthalpy of the H-F bond. Because the fluorine atom is so small, the bond enthalpy (bond energy) of the hydrogen-fluorine bond is very high. The chart below gives values for all the hydrogen-halogen bond enthalpies: bond enthalpy (kJ mol-1) H-F +562: H-Cl +431: H-Br +366: H-I +299: WebThe enthalpy of a reaction can be estimated based on the energy input required to break bonds and the energy released when new bonds are formed.
